bearishJan 27, 2025 · 07:26 PM

Stocks Sink in Broad AI Rout Sparked by China's DeepSeek

U.S. stocks experienced a significant downturn, primarily driven by a broad sell-off in artificial intelligence (AI) related companies. The Nasdaq index led these declines, with many AI infrastructure providers suffering steep, double-digit percentage falls. This market rout was reportedly initiated by developments concerning China's DeepSeek. A prominent example of the impact was Nvidia, whose stock price dropped by a substantial 16%. The overall market sentiment turned bearish, especially for the technology sector heavily reliant on AI innovation.
